Benro TMA27A Series 2 Mach3 Aluminum Tripod
This tripod supports up to 26.5 lbs, offering stability for heavy gear. Its aluminum construction and twist lock legs extend to a height of 63.6 inches. Convert it into a monopod for versatility. Swap rubber feet for metal spikes to adapt to different terrains. Adjust the center column for low-angle shots and add weight via the ballast hook for extra stability. The included carrying case ensures easy transport, while the 3/8"-16 threaded stud allows custom head attachments.

Specifications
| Load Capacity | 26.5 lb / 12 kg |
|---|---|
| Maximum Working Height | 63.6" / 161.5 cm |
| Max Height without Center Column | 53.1" / 135 cm |
| Minimum Working Height | 15.2" / 38.6 cm |
| Folded Length | 24.6" / 62.5 cm |
| Head Mount Type | 3/8"-16 Screw |
| Weight | 3.9 lb / 1.8 kg |
| Materials | Aluminum Alloy |
| Legs | |
| Leg Lock Type | Twist Lock |
| Independent Leg Spread | Yes |
| Leg Sections | 3 |
| Feet Features | Spiked, Retractable |
